The Eagles’ most recent coach, Jeff Monken, just left the Statesboro school to take over as the head coach at Army. Kleinlein told the Macon Telegraph Monken made $260,000 as the coach at Georgia Southern last year.
Bobo, on the other hand, made $585,000 in 2013. Bobo made less than at least two coaches who were fired last year – Manny Diaz (Texas defensive coordinator; $650,000) and Brent Pease (Florida; $600,000).
Bobo blistered several coordinators who make more than he does including scoring at least 35 points on: LSU’s John Chavis (44 points; $1.1 million), Georgia Tech’s Ted Roof (41 points; $600,000), South Carolina’s Lorenzo Ward (41 points; $650,000), Auburn’s Ellis Johnson (38 points; $800,000) and Clemson’s Brent Venables (35 points, $800,000).
